From 09e957eec11ac38a4c6dcef9012aa4ab8de9fb5b Mon Sep 17 00:00:00 2001 From: Tobias Klauser Date: Tue, 17 Feb 2015 18:00:40 +0100 Subject: all: Add version information Signed-off-by: Tobias Klauser --- Makefile |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) (limited to 'Makefile') diff --git a/Makefile b/Makefile index 14c93cb..3b06b95 100644 --- a/Makefile +++ b/Makefile @@ -2,6 +2,8 @@ # # Copyright (C) 2014-2015 Tobias Klauser +VERSION = 0.1-rc1 + # llmnrd binary D_P = llmnrd D_OBJS = llmnr.o iface.o socket.o util.o llmnrd.o @@ -18,12 +20,15 @@ INSTALL = install CFLAGS ?= -W -Wall -O2 LDFLAGS ?= +CFLAGS += -DVERSION_STRING=\"v$(VERSION)\" + ifeq ($(DEBUG), 1) CFLAGS += -g -DDEBUG endif -CCQ = @echo " CC $<" && $(CC) -LDQ = @echo " LD $@" && $(CC) +Q ?= @ +CCQ = $(Q)echo " CC $<" && $(CC) +LDQ = $(Q)echo " LD $@" && $(CC) prefix ?= /usr/local -- cgit v1.2.3-54-g00ecf